LunarCrush provides real-time social intelligence for crypto assets. Your AI agent uses this server to monitor community sentiment, track key proprietary metrics like Galaxy Score and AltRank, and access live market data for thousands of digital coins.
You can compare a coin's social buzz against its current price, making it easy to spot potential trends before the rest of the market catches on.

What you can do with this MCP connector
LunarCrush gives your AI agent deep social intelligence on crypto assets. This server lets you monitor community sentiment and track proprietary metrics—like Galaxy Score and AltRank—for thousands of digital coins. You're checking if a coin's buzz is matching the market hype.
Getting Started: Building Your Watchlist
Start by building your asset list. Use list_assets to grab the full roster of supported crypto assets. This function returns all available symbols, letting you filter that data right away—you can narrow it down by a specific symbol or by rank if you only want to see the top dogs.
You'll get a structured list that lets your agent build out reports on demand.
Deep Dive into Community Buzz: The Raw Data
Want to know what people are actually saying? Use get_social_metrics. This tool pulls granular data points for any specific coin. It gives you mention counts, engagement rates, and the overall calculated sentiment score. You're not just getting a number; you're seeing the raw health of the community discussion around that asset.
Measuring Social Performance: AltRank
To see how an asset stacks up against the competition, run get_altrank. This function gives you a coin’s AltRank score. Think of it like this: it ranks the asset's current social buzz performance against every other crypto in the market. It immediately shows if a coin is trending hard or getting ignored.
Calculating Combined Health Scores: Galaxy Score
For a quick, single measure of total health, call get_galaxy_score. This tool calculates a combined Galaxy Score for any given asset. What it does under the hood is cross-reference both historical market data and current social volume into one score. It's way faster than looking at metrics separately.
Market Context: Real-Time Finance
No point analyzing buzz without knowing the price action. Use get_market_metrics to pull real-time financial information for any coin. This returns live data points, including the current market price, total trading volume over a set period, and the asset's total market capitalization. You combine this live money flow with your social metrics to get the full picture.
How It Works Together
Your agent uses these tools sequentially. First, it grabs the list of assets using list_assets. Then, for a specific coin, it calls get_social_metrics to nail down sentiment. Next, it runs get_altrank to see how that buzz ranks globally. It simultaneously pulls get_market_metrics to know what the price is doing right now.
Finally, it wraps all that data up by running get_galaxy_score, giving you a comprehensive, single score that tells you if the coin's social life matches its financial backing.

Common Questions About LunarCrush MCP
How do I find out what coins are supported by LunarCrush? Using `list_assets`? +
Run the list_assets tool. It returns a complete list of all assets the server supports, and you can filter this initial data set by symbol or rank if needed.
Can I compare social buzz against market cap? Which tools do I use? +
Yes. You need to combine get_social_metrics for the sentiment/mentions, and then run get_market_metrics to pull the real-time market capitalization. The agent will stitch these two data points together for comparison.
What is better: AltRank or Galaxy Score? +
It depends on your goal. Use get_altrank when you need to know how an asset stacks up against the entire market's buzz. Use get_galaxy_score when you want a holistic, combined score of social activity and historical performance.
Do I have to run multiple tools for one coin? Is it efficient? +
No. Your agent is designed to manage the sequence. You can ask for 'everything'—and the agent will call get_market_metrics, get_social_metrics, and others sequentially, delivering a single, comprehensive result.
What do I need to successfully run `get_galaxy_score`? +
You must provide a valid LunarCrush API Key for authentication. The key grants your AI client access, and you'll need an active subscription linked to that credential.
Am I limited when running multiple checks with `get_social_metrics`? +
Yes, there are rate limits on the number of calls in a short period. We recommend batching your requests or implementing an exponential backoff strategy in your agent code.
Does `get_market_metrics` provide historical price points, or just real-time data? +
It provides current, real-time market metrics like price and volume. If you need deeper historical charts, you'll have to use a dedicated charting API outside of this server.
How can I use `list_assets` to filter assets by ranking or category? +
You can pass specific parameters like rank ranges or categories into the function call. This allows you to narrow down the list significantly without needing multiple searches.
What does the Galaxy Score represent for a coin? +
The Galaxy Score, retrieved via get_galaxy_score, indicates how a coin is performing relative to its own historical social and market performance. A higher score suggests stronger combined health.
How can I compare a coin's social performance against the entire market? +
Use the get_altrank tool. It measures a coin's social performance relative to the entire crypto market, helping you identify assets that are gaining significant social traction.
Can I get social sentiment for specific time intervals? +
Yes! The get_social_metrics tool allows you to specify an interval (1h, 24h, or 7d) to retrieve mentions, engagement, and sentiment for a specific coin symbol.
